Quote:
Originally Posted by LowRanger View Post
Thanks!

I don't slap/pop, so what's the deal with Tal's sound? Light gage strings played with a heavy touch. She's got a great groove.

Oteil is from another planet. Killer stuff.
+1 That's the classic 'heavy touch played close to the neck with ss roundwound' J tone. I totally dig it, and that's just a great example of the Sadowsky J tone with single coils when you really dig in IMO and IME.
